Grounding Techniques That Actually Work (And Why Most Don't)

Grounding advice is everywhere, and much of it fails — not because grounding doesn't work, but because techniques are handed out with no attention to which state your nervous system is actually in. A tool that calms an anxious system can push a shut-down system further away. Here is how to match the technique to the moment.

First, locate yourself

Ask: am I revved up (racing thoughts, tight chest, restless, irritable) or am I shut down (numb, foggy, heavy, far away)? These need opposite medicine.

If you are revved up: discharge first

An activated system has energy that needs somewhere to go. Stillness often backfires here — which is why being told to "sit and breathe" can make anxiety worse.

  • **Lengthen the exhale.** Inhale for four, exhale for eight. The long exhale is a direct signal to the vagus nerve. Two minutes, minimum
  • **Push.** Press your palms hard against a wall for thirty seconds. Feel your muscles complete the effort your body has been holding
  • **Orient.** Slowly turn your head and let your eyes land on five things around you. You are telling an ancient system: I have looked, and there is no lion
  • **Cold water on the wrists or face.** Crude, effective, backed by physiology

If you are shut down: warm the system gently

A dorsal, numb state does not need stimulation — it needs safe, gradual invitation back.

  • **Weight and warmth.** A heavy blanket, a hot water bottle on the chest, warm socks. The body reads these as safety
  • **Rock.** Sit and rock gently forward and back. It is how we were first regulated, and the body never forgets
  • **Hum.** Humming vibrates the vagus nerve directly. A few minutes of low humming is one of the most underrated practices I know
  • **One sense at a time.** Not 5-4-3-2-1 all at once — just one texture, felt slowly. Shutdown systems are overwhelmed by too much, too fast

Why grounding alone isn't the whole answer

Techniques are first aid. They manage states; they do not resolve why your system leaves safety so easily in the first place. That deeper repatterning happens through consistent, relational work — a regulated nervous system alongside yours, teaching your body what techniques alone cannot.
